1.  Create a MySpace Layout that showcases your business.

A clean and attractive MySpace layout that includes your company name and a description of your products and services is essential in marketing yourself to the MySpace crowd.

When you consider that one of the most popularly searched phrases on the Internet today is "MySpace Layouts", you'll understand just how important this tip is.  Aside from the popularity of social networking itself, the second fastest growing trend is customization, or the art of being able to decorate your profile with cool layouts, backgrounds, pictures, graphics and video and music applications that convey your likes and dislikes and, in essence, your overall personality to the friends who visit your page.

It's no different if you're a business.  Posting a layout to your MySpace page, one that clearly conveys who you are and what you do, speaks volumes to the people visiting your profile – people who may very well become your customers.

Look online to find websites that offer custom layouts and incorporate your company's information and graphics into the elements of your layout design, including backgrounds, extended network banners and boxes within the layout such as contact tables.  Whatever you do, keep it simple. Cluttered and confusing layouts lose their branding effectiveness.

2.  Add MySpace friends who fit the demographic profile of your customers.

MySpace has a nifty feature that allows you to browse for friends by age, gender and relationship status.  Use this tool to locate friend prospects that fit the demographic profile of your target customers and reach out to those prospects with friend requests.  When you add friends who you believe will be most interested in learning of and receiving information about your products and services, you increase your chances of gaining new customers through targeted marketing.

Be sure to communicate important company news such as discounts and special deals or the launch of new products and services to your MySpace friends as often as you can, in a reasonable manner.  Keep in mind MySpace has safeguards in place to prevent spamming.

3.  Work your MySpace profile.

Having a MySpace profile that features your business is one thing, "working" that profile so it works for your business is something completely different.

Assign someone within your company to manage your profile on a daily basis.  It's important that they add friends, post comments, post bulletins, write blog articles and send and receive messages. Don't assume that by creating a MySpace profile, millions of people will find you.  The art of social networking is just that – networking socially within a site like MySpace by reaching out, making friends and interacting with those friends as often as possible.

Also, aside from foul language or inappropriate content, don't be afraid to allow people to post public comments about your organization on your MySpace page.  A big draw for social networking is the ability to be real, to speak your mind and say how you feel.  If you allow only positive comments about your business to be posted, you lose credibility.  But if you allow people to speak their minds, you gain credibility while learning a lot about your customers – and your business – in the process.

Myspace Marketing - How To Market Your Business For Free On Myspace

Myspace.com is the world's largest social networking website. It is the cool place to be if you are in your teens, 20s and 30s. I have also found that it can be an outstanding free marketing tool for social business and websites.

So what is Myspace.com? Myspace is a website where anybody in the world can create a free "personal" web page (i.e., my space). Once you have created your personal web page on myspace, then you can connect your page to other people's myspace pages by clicking on a link to request to be a person's friend. Once that person agrees to be your friend, then you and that person can email each other, chat with each other, leave comments on each other's myspace pages, and read each other's blogs. There is no limit to the number of friends you can have and some of the more popular people on myspace have millions of myspace friends and have actually become Internet celebrities and have been featured on talk shows.

Over the past year I have been conducting test marketing on myspace for a couple of my clients and I have discovered that myspace can be a very good free marketing tool for businesses. However, myspace is not for all businesses. The types of business that will do well having a myspace page are the "cool" types of businesses that want to market to people in their 20s and 30s. Businesses that will have luck marketing on myspace include bars, clubs, "hip" clothing stores, and cool Internet websites.

Here is how to market your business on myspace.com:

1. Go to myspace.com and create a free profile. Make sure to talk first about yourself and then about your business. However, you must consider your myspace page a personal page where you talk mostly about you and a little about your business. Do not just talk about your business because if you do, people will not want to be your friend. You need to focus on the personal aspect such as, "hey this is me and my life. And by the way I run this Internet website that sells cool t-shirts." If you think of myspace as a place to network and meet friends FIRST and market your business SECOND, then you will do well on myspace.

2. Once you have created your myspace page, click the browse link to find the type of people you want to market to. You can search by gender, age, location, ethnicity, etc.

3. Go to each person's page and click their "Add to friends" link. The person will either approve you or deny you. If they approve you, your myspace page and their myspace page will be connected as being friends.

4. To market your business, post friendly personalized bulletins. When you post a bulletin, a link to your bulletin will be posted on each of your friend's myspace pages. If you have 5,000 myspace friends, than you can literally have a message sent to all 5,000 of these people for free. However, remember that you must be personal with your messages. Talk like you are talking to your best friend. Do NOT talk to people like customers. Myspace is a place for friends and you must respect that.

5. Post friendly comments on your myspace friends' pages and include a link to your website. Then, everybody who goes to your friend's myspace page will see your comment and your link. Some will click on your picture to become your friend and some will click on the link to go to your website.

The Marketing Potential Of Myspace

MySpace.com is home to arguably one of the largest social networks in the world. Thousands of users join for various reasons, whether it's to make friends, share photos and videos or to promote their own music. As the MySpace tend grows in popularity, members of the competitive marketing industry have discovered the gold mine that MySpace really is when it comes to its advertising potential.

There are a number of tools and methods, which allow users to maximize their space's marketing potential and benefit from access to such a large community.

Firstly, the wider your audience, the higher success chances there are of your scheme really working. There are a number of automatic programs which allow users to collect friends and build up a strong contact list. Yet, many users find that the personal approach is better since it allows people to target their audience, even if it does take longer. This means going through a number of profiles, and friend requesting those who deem appropriate recipients to your advertising spear, even though there is a limit to how many people you add in a day. This approach is especially useful for niche businesses that cater to a significant target market.

A faster, and easier way of building up your friends list, is MySpace Train. This is a script that makes users post their profile on a page, and allows other users to add them.

Once full, MySpace Train is reset for more users to add the marketer. Even though it's a very basic method, it is probably the fastest and easiest way of getting friends since there is no limit to how many requests you get. This approach is not useful for those catering to a niche market, as the friends collected in this way, are absolutely random.

Once the marketer has collected and built up a large contact list that is ready to be advertised to, there are a few steps that need to be taken to ensure your "friends" interest and obligation to your persona. This is usually done by creating a captivating and interesting profile, based on your niche market. If you don't complete a profile, most users will notice something is wrong - and will take you off their friends list. It is best if you include personal details, a few photographs and update your blog at least twice a week. Also, changing the look of your page also adds a personal touch and adds to that growing list of friends. The friend-requesting process is most successful if all these details are taken care of in the beginning. Another technique is to stay in touch with your friends and leave comments on their MySpace page. This ensures that people visit your profile regularly, and are subject to whatever marketing techniques you are employing.

Once your friends list is ready, and you are a popular member of the family, it is time for the wheels to start moving. Enter- your marketing plan!

One of the greatest advertising tools at your service is the bulletins option. Bulletins can be likened to forum posts, but they can't be replied to and are only visible to users on your friends list. These are especially useful if you have a targeted list of friends. But beware that if you post too many advertising bulletins, most people will drive you to the edges of the MySpace circle and you will be subject to your friends' annoyance. Thus, it is best that you post them in rarity, with no more than four bulletins per month. Do remember that since you have access to graphics and flash in your bulletins, try to make them original, interesting and an able vehicle that delivers your product with expertise.

Another great method that is employed is mass messaging. This works well for both target and bulk marketers, since it allows a huge number of users to receive your message. Although, it is easier for those targeting a niche market, since they won't have to send out as many messages, and the messages will be relevant and interesting for the recipients. This can be done by using an automated messaging program. It is important to write an informative message but ensure that it sounds personal and include the link to your site at the bottom of the message. If users appreciate your message and find it useful, they will probably pass it on to their friends - and thus the never-ending, profit making chain of viral marketing will commence.

Guerilla Marketing on Myspace: Smart Do-it-yourself Online Marketing

I think it's fair to say that if you haven't heard of MySpace.com, you may have been asleep in the past couple of years or kidnapped by aliens.

According to Alexa.com, MySpace.com is the third most popular website in the world, after Yahoo.com and Google.com. It is a free service to anyone on the planet, so it is of no surprise that there are over 150 million profiles worldwide and counting, residing on MySpace. What this means to you is a big, wide playground to market and manipulate your product to attract users to visit your MySpace page. As you have probably noticed, every celebrity, actor, film production company, or even a new movie that is coming out has it's own MySpace page. A friend's cat “Joe the Cat” even has his own MySpace page. Such “moldability” makes this site desirable for anyone to sell and market a product – for free.

Friends

A feature on MySpace is the ability to add friends or profiles. This allows the user to gather multiple potential customers and store it in their own database to be easily accessible. Friends can leave comments on your page, photos, and such. There are hacks available and floating everywhere that promises to give you x-amount of friends for a few dollars. But, keep in mind that not all friends are good friends. If you are selling something to a target audience, think quality not quantity. For example, if you are selling hip hop music, think of your target demographic audience. It does you no good to have 10,000 friends – half of which listen to pop music, a fourth listens to metal, and a fourth listens to hip hop. You will literally have to have millions of friends on your MySpace page in order to reach a level of awareness for your target demographic. This is like having a machine gun and spraying your target with bullets. You will need a million bullets to hit the target. You are just shooting in the dark, but you eventually hit your target by sheer volume of bullets.

I say be a practiced “sharp shooter” on MySpace. Refine your friends. Myspace has a search feature that lets you use keywords to find profiles that contain those words. So, in our example of hip hop music, type in the keywords, “hip hop” or “rap” and it gives you profiles that contain those words. You have now increased your likelihood of gaining friends who have a high percentage of visiting your page and patronizing your product.

Also, think of your marketing goals. Again, using our example of a hip hop artist, your goal is to gain exposure from DJs, management companies, record companies, or maybe publications for interviews. Type in these key words on the search feature and you will get hundreds of profiles of companies and individuals involved in these industries.

So, the lesson is – unless you have the time and manpower to do it, “Don't work so hard to get so many friends. Be smarter and save time and energy to get the right type of friends on MySpace.”

Now that you have friends, what are you going to do with them to promote your product. MySpace has several wonderful marketing tools that are generally underutilized by talented artists and legitimate businesses, but sometimes abused by nefarious entities to steal profile usernames and passwords, and sell products in a dishonest and deceitful m anner.

Blogs

When I first started blogging on MySpace on my personal profile, I gained quite a following because of some strategies that I implemented. It almost became a job to perpetuate the level of readership that I had on my blogs. But, the hard work and time I invested paid off, because after a few weeks, I had hundreds of subscribers and would get over 50, sometimes over 100 comments on my blogs regularly. I began to think, “This is like a job. Wouldn't it be nice to get paid for this?”

As an entrepreuner and your own marketing specialist, these strategies can be implemented on your own blogs on MySpace to increase product awareness for your own business. It is an alternative way to drive traffic to your website. Follow some of these simple strategies: Identify your target audience (i.e. Magazines, record companies, journalists, females between 18-40, etc.). Once you have identified your target audience. Go into their profiles, into the Blog Section, and click on the “Invite to my Blog” link. This generates an automatic email that invites them to subscribe to your blog. I would follow this up with emails to introduce yourself. Be friendly and tone down the “I'm selling something” sentiments. Write your blogs. Be informative not vague. Be aproachable, not stiff. Be personable, not too corporate. MySpace is an informal arena and corporate mumbo-jumbo has little place in this social forum. Invite your readers to respond. Engage them in discussion. Even mention them by name in your entries. You may have to write them an email from time to time to alert them of your blog. The old adage, “You scratch my back I scratch yours, ” holds true in blogging. Go on your readers' sites and see if they blog. If they do, read and contribute to their blog by commenting. This increases the likelihood of that user and any other user who reads his blog to come to your blog. Any comments on other users blogs is a great advertisement for your own MySpace page as it is a direct link to your own profile.

Banners

Create catchy banners on your main page to link to your official website. You don't have to pay for these. You can go on sites such as www.mybannermaker.com and you can create a free banner that you can embed onto your MySpace page, linking it to any URL. Create your banner, grab the code, and paste it onto your “About Me” section, and you have successfully implemented one of the most effective do-it-yourself marketing tools on MySpace.

You can even create banners to link to the “Subscribe to my Blog” section or “Add me as a friend” so that users only have to click one button to subscribe or add you as a friend.

Comments

Another great feature for marketing on MySpace is the ability of your “friends” to leave comments on your page. As a business owner, or music artists, fans and customers will leave you comments here about how much they love your product or music. Also, other product peddlers are able to leave their marketing ads on your page as well. Make the “comment” feature work for you. Try these simple do-it-yourself strategies.

When a new user requests you to be a “friend”, use this opportunity to market your product. Accept them into your list, and then leave them a comment on their profile to thank them for having you on their friends list. A great eye-catchy yet unobtrusive comment is an art. Have you seen those huge banners and long comments on people's profile? They are of poor taste and the likelihood of the “friend” keeping that huge tacky comment on his page is not good. So construct a tasteful comment. An example of a tasteful comment might be, “Thanks so much for adding me to your friends list. You're welcome to come by and visit my page anytime and check me out. Don't be a stranger. - Joe, the model.” Create a banner (not so big) that will link it to your MySpace page or your official website, and make this your signature logo after your comment. When there is a change in your product, you have a special offer, new music, or new blog, you can create links, create a banner or both and incorporate that into your comment to users. For example, “Hi, hope all is well with you. I hope you had a great birthday. I just wanted to update you on what's going on with me. I just blogged and I wanted to share some really cool information with you. Click this link to go to my blog/my page. Hope to see you there.” Remember by commenting on as many people as you can in a tasteful manner, you are increasing awareness for your page and product, and increasing the likelihood that users will visit your page or website and patronize your product.

Bulletins

Bulletins on MySpace are an iffy subject for me. I doubt the usefuleness of this feature. Furthermore, it is saturated by users who send the same bulletins over 10 sometimes more a day. It is a valuable tool if done tastefully, but I really doubt the usefulness when you weigh the risks and benefits of using this feature. There are so many users that abuse this feature that MySpace admin has finally added a button at the bottom of each bulletin to “delete this friend”. So, it is really important to keep in mind when you send bulletins that you are also sending a button for friends to delete you if they don't like the bulletin you sent.

At any rate, when you absolutely have to send a bulletin, remember to do it tastefully, and don't send it more than 5 times in a day. Space them out accordingly and strategically, keeping in mind the time zones.

Also, avoid creating links like, “Check this out”, “This is so hilarious”, “You can't believe this.” Users are now used to getting these bulletins and getting their profiles hacked. MySpace has been riddled with phishing hacks that typically contain those phrases I mentioned. When you clicked on them, they went to another site and it seemed that you are logged off of MySpace. The site then asks you for your Myspace username and password. MySpace admin has alerted users of the hackers tactics. Now, when users see links like the above, your bulletin can look like an attempt to hack their site, and you are likely to get deleted from their friends list.

MySpace has long been hailed as the next big thing in high volume websites, and for good reason. Its visitor stats are impressive, and to some people this makes it ripe for marketing with MySpace. But, given the nature of the site and other Web 2.0 phenomena, is it ethical to treat MySpace as just another prospect to make money? This article examines some of the dilemmas of MySpace marketing that seem to present themselves.

MySpace now has over 140 million members worldwide. It has over twice the website traffic as the mighty Google. But the most astonishing aspect of MySpace, from the marketer's point of view, is that its membership can be analyzed by several different demographic metrics including gender, age, location, ethnicity, earning power (albeit self-declared) and even whether the member is a smoker or not.

MySpace members also get the chance to join specific niche interest groups. So you can immediately join a group of your choice - searching by keywords if you want - and start interacting with other people who have the same espoused interests. Once you are a member of a group, or you have contacted a number of people who have agreed to become your "friends", you can post messages to them on subjects that you know are of interest to them. Moreover, by sending comments to them (as opposed to just bulletins) your messages can be seen not only by your "friends" but by all of their friends as well. So you have a pre-sold, viral, automatic sales machine with no overhead.

Just imagine that! Various data protection laws around the world wouldn't allow you that much information so readily available about specified individuals. This is surely the marketer's dream come true, the candy on a plate! MySpace marketing has arrived!

But wait a minute. This is a social networking site. That's S-O-C-I-A-L. It's part of the new Internet, the face of Web 2.0. We can't just go in there and plunder!

Too right we can't. Or we'd have our accounts deleted very quickly. The MySpace Terms of Service expressly forbids blatant marketing on the site (you would do well to read the MySpace ToS at this point - it's at http://www.myspace.com/Modules/Common/Pages/TermsConditions.aspx). But as with everything else there are ways and means. MySpace marketing has to be done very gently indeed.

It is a fine line indeed between marketing a product and recommending it in passing to a friend who is already known to be interested in similar products or related activities. Go in there with both feet and your MySpace profile will not be there the next time you try to log in. The way to do it is to casually mention it. But do not use affiliate links if it isn't your own product or service. Instead, encourage the reader (your "friend") to go to your own website, or to go to your MySpace profile where there will be other links to your own site. Once on your own site, of course, you can have whatever links you like, where you wish.

Your offering must be seen as an enhancement to your readers, not an intrusion. As for blatant sales approaches, they will be spotted immediately, and the user will then have ample opportunity to report your message as spam or abusive. Enough of those spam reports of your MySpace marketing activities and your account will be shut down.

Keep your MySpace marketing clean and subdued. You don't go to your club and expect people to grab you by the collar and then try to sell you the latest widget, so don't do that to other people.

You should treat all this as positive. Why shouldn't you? After all, MySpace is a genuinely great way of networking within your own niche. Within each profile you have the opportunity of making use of all its facilities. That includes your own blog within each account. It allows html in all profile and blogs, and also in the various messages you can send to other members. So it pays to learn a little basic html if you don't know it already. You can also get a huge amount of pre-made designs to deck out your profile, but don't go over the top with pages that take too long to load or are difficult to navigate. You should make visits to your profile an enjoyable experience.

Also bear in mind that MySpace pages tend to be ranked quite highly in the search engines. So use this to your advantage when optimizing pages for keywords. This is particularly true of MySpace blogs, so keep each posting tightly focussed on one keyword only.
